A RAIL company is celebrating achieving some of the highest overall scores for long-distance franchised operators.
Virgin Trains leads the way in the latest National Rail Passenger Survey (NRPS), scoring 92 per cent customer satisfaction on its East Coast Mainline franchise.
David Horne, Virgin Trains managing director on the east coast said: “These figures are a testament to our continued investment in services on the east coast and demonstrate that we are continuing to deliver for passengers.”
Virgin Trains East Coast, a partnership between Stagecoach and Sir Richard Branson’s Virgin, is the subject of a controversial “bailout”, with the Government deciding to cut short its contract.
